Understandably, Ukraine has repeatedly denied claims that it is targeting Russian units on Russian soil.

Despite my fervent support for Ukraine, I have to acknowledge that Ukraine is also playing an information war. And they most certainly have incentives to lie about their war efforts, especially when they have to balance utilitarian decision-making with creating PR conditions to receive military supplies from the West (namely, the US).

Officially, Zelensky claimed: “We don’t attack Russian territory, we liberate our own legitimate territory.” He continued, “We have neither the time nor the strength (to attack Russia).”

But what are we to make about the numerous explosions on Russian land? Is it possible that Ukraine has indeed targeted Russian units within its territory?

Let’s discuss.

Photo by Kevin Schmid on Unsplash

First, it’s important to note that Ukraine has allegiances with Russian units. Not many are aware of this. And they are technically separate from the Ukrainian military, so Ukraine can deny any collaboration between the two.

The two units I have in mind here are the Russian Volunteer Corps and the Freedom of Russia Legion.

Is it possible that Ukraine occasionally commands these units? Well, yes. It’s definitely possible…
